Output d7bf4756fa8510776e3cd7b499c12e1817573b137b7998002e834dd822154e00:4

value
4028491
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52b24411ee9e1ca1bd99c89205b30aa737f9e275 OP_EQUAL
address
39EGtQUnYJPrYNNf7m2q39VmS1BpWQHPYo
transaction
d7bf4756fa8510776e3cd7b499c12e1817573b137b7998002e834dd822154e00
confirmations
359889
spent
true